Puppy mill manager gets six months, not ordered to pay Humane Society

A state judge sentenced the former manager of a Waimanalo dog breeding facility to six months in jail this morning for 153 counts of animal cruelty.

With credit for the time he has already spent in custody since his arrest in June, David Lee Becker, 55, will be released from custody as soon as state prison officials receive the judgement and verify that Becker has already served the six months and has no other cases pending.

Circuit Judge Glenn Kim refused the state’s request to order Becker to repay the Hawaiian Humane Society the $370,701 it spent to care for the 153 dogs it rescued from squalid conditions in February 2010 because he said the Humane Society is not a direct victim of the animal cruelty.
